INTRODUCTION Ths specfcaton covers the requrements for applcaton of Power Seres 50 connector assembles n hghcurrent systems for power supples, battery chargers, telecommuncatons, and materal handlng equpment. The connector assembly conssts of a hermaphrodtc housng and two closed barrel contacts. The contacts are avalable n szes 6, 8, and and accept wre szes (AWG) that correspond to the contact sze. Reducng bushngs are avalable for contact sze 6 to accommodate smaller wre szes to a mnmum of sze 16 AWG. These contacts feature a flared wre barrel and round-ended tab. The contacts are avalable n loose-pece for termnatng wth manual or pneumatc hand-held tools and n reeled form for termnatng wth sem-automatc machnes. The housng features two contact cavtes each marked on top of the housng wth a plus (+) to ndcate postve polarty and a mnus (-) to ndcate negatve polarty. Each contact s held n the cavty by an nternal retanng sprng. The hermaphrodtc desgn of the housng ensures proper polarty n matng of the connectors. In addton, the housngs are color coded to provde vsual reference for proper matng and a molded-n mechancal key at the matng face prevents nadvertent matng of dfferent colored housngs (housngs wth same poston keys wll only engage housngs of the same color). The housng color s also coded for recommended applcaton voltage. When correspondng wth personnel, use the termnology provded n ths specfcaton to facltate your nqures for nformaton. Documents avalable whch pertan to ths product are: Ratcheted Cable Cutter Hand Tool Heavy Duty Cable Cutter Hand Tool Heavy Duty Cable Cutter Hand Tool Heavy Duty Cable Cutter Hand Tool General Preventve Mantenance for Mnature Quck-Change Applcators Crmp Tool Power Seres 50 Connector Assembles Cable Strpper/Sltter Tool Handlng of Reeled Products AMP-TAPETRONIC* Machne REQUIREMENTS IMPORTANT: Usng the exact products and applcaton requrements descrbed n ths document wll ensure proper applcaton; however, to ensure relablty of performance, t s hghly recommended that an ndependent evaluaton be conducted of the chosen product combnatons (wre, connector assembles, and system) before fnal applcaton s approved Specal Assembly Consderatons and Safety These connectors MUST NOT be used for nterruptng current; otherwse, there s rsk of electrcal shock. In any case, the electrcal power supply must ALWAYS BE DISCONNECTED, and the connectors must ALWAYS BE DE-ENERGIZED (ths mght nclude dsconnectng the cable from the battery) before matng and unmatng or servcng the connectors. It s hghly recommended that these connectors not be used n external power applcatons where the electrcal potental exceeds 42 V. In applcatons where these connectors are located nternal to a devce and do not serve as the prmary means of connecton, hgh voltages are allowable. It must be determned by the orgnal equpment manufacturer (OEM) whether the connectors meet electrcal and safety requrements when used n a specfc applcaton. DANGER In applcatons where the connectors are used external to a devce or as the prmary means of dsconnectng power supples or chargng equpment, care must be taken to avod touchng exposed electrcal contacts as there s rsk of STOP electrc shock. 2 of 9

3 3.2. Lmtatons Ths product s desgned to operate n a temperature range of -20 to 105 C [-4 to 221 F] Materal The housng s made of polycarbonate, rated 94 V-0 by Underwrters Laboratores Inc. (UL). The sprngs (nsde the housng) are made of stanless steel. The contacts and reducng bushng are made of copper plated wth slver Storage A. Ultravolet Lght Prolonged exposure to ultravolet lght may deterorate the chemcal composton used n the housng materal. B. Shelf Lfe The housngs and contacts should reman n the shppng contaners untl ready for use to prevent deformaton. The housngs and contacts should be used on a frst n, frst out bass to avod storage contamnaton that could adversely affect performance. C. Chemcal Exposure Do not store housngs or contacts near any chemcal lsted below as they may cause dscoloraton of the plated fnsh of the contacts or stress corroson crackng n the housng or contact materal. Alkales Ammona Ctrates Phosphates Ctrates Sulfur Compounds Amnes Carbonates Ntrtes Sulfur Ntrtes Tartrates 3.5. Wre Selecton and Preparaton The contacts accept stranded (recommended a mnmum of 19 strands) copper wre szes 6 through 12 AWG wth a maxmum nsulaton dameter of mm [.440 n.]. Contact sze 6 can accept smaller wre szes to a mnmum of sze 16 AWG wth the use of the approprate sze reducng bushng (as descrbed n Paragraph 3.6). Wres wth less than 19 strands may be too stff and dffcult to work wth. Tarnshed copper wre must be thoroughly cleaned usng a stff wre brush, or other sutable method, that penetrates the entre bundle and cleans every conductor. The wre must be restored to a brght copper fnsh. The contact wre barrels are lned wth slver platng to assure consstently hgh conductvty whch wll be reduced f tarnshed wre s used. The wre must be cut to length. Proper strp length s necessary to properly nsert the conductors nto the contact. The strp length of the wre s shown n Fgure 2. 4 3.6. Reducng Bushng Reducng bushngs are avalable for contact sze 6 to accommodate smaller wre szes to a mnmum of sze 16 AWG. When requred, the approprate sze reducng bushng must be nstalled onto the wre before nsertng the wre nto the contact (the reducng bushng can be nstalled onto the wre before or after strppng the wre). Placement of the reducng bushng must meet the requrements shown n Fgure 3. Placement of Reducng Bushng os Strpped Wre Ends of Conductors Must Be Vsble Wre Insulaton Must Not Enter Reducng Bushng Placement of Wre and Reducng Bushng n Contact Contact Sze 6 Wre and Reducng Bushng Must Be Straght n Relaton to Contact Wre Barrel 3.7. Crmp Requrements A. Reducng Bushng Fgure 3 If a reducng bushng s used, the reducng bushng must be held frmly nsde the contact wre barrel. The reducng bushng must be straght n relaton to the wre barrel and can protrude from the wre barrel to the dmenson provded n Fgure 4. B. Tab The contact tab must not be deformed n any way. See Fgure 4. C. Wre Barrel Crmp All conductors must be held frmly nsde the wre barrel. The crmp appled to the contact wre barrel s the most compressed area and most crtcal n ensurng optmum performance of the crmped contact. The crmped area must be symmetrcal on both sdes of the wre barrel as shown n Fgure 4. The developed crmp confguratons result from usng the specfc toolng descrbed n Secton 5, TOOLING. D. Wre Conductor and Insulaton Locaton No conductors can be folded back over the wre nsulaton. The nsulaton must not enter the wre barrel. The conductors must be vsble between the reducng bushng, f applcable, or contact wre barrel and the wre nsulaton wthn the dmenson stated n Fgure 4. 4 of 9

Keyng Fgure 6 Assurance of proper matng s provded by a molded-n mechancal key at the matng face of the housng. The poston of the key of the matng housngs must be compatble. The customer drawng for the specfc housng provdes the key poston. Other key postons are avalable upon request Installng Contacts nto Housng DANGER The electrcal supply MUST BE DISCONNECTED and the connectors MUST BE DE-ENERGIZED (ths mght nclude dsconnectng the cable from the battery) before nstallng the contacts nto the housng. STOP The contacts must NOT be forced nto the housng. Each contact must be nstalled n the housng accordng to the followng requrements. 1. Each contact must be nserted nto the wre sde of the housng. 2. The bottom of each contact must face the retenton sprng of the housng. 3. Each contact must be n straght algnment wth the contact cavty. 4. Each contact must be fully latched onto the housng retanng sprng Removng Contacts from Housng The housng retenton sprng must be depressed away from the undersde of the contact to remove the contact from the housng. A contact must be removed from the housng accordng to the followng: 6 of 9

7 DANGER The electrcal supply MUST BE DISCONNECTED and the connectors MUST BE DE-ENERGIZED (ths mght nclude dsconnectng the cable from the battery) before removng the contacts from the housng. STOP Secton 5 lsts avalable extracton tools used to remove these contacts. 1. The tp of the tool must be nserted between the sdes of contact and the contact cavty at the matng face of the housng. 2. The handle of the tool must be pushed down so that the housng retenton sprng s depressed away from the undersde of the contact. Whle holdng the tool n poston, the wre must be pushed down and gently pulled back untl the contact s free from the housng Matng and Unmatng Connectors DANGER The electrcal supply MUST BE DISCONNECTED and the connectors MUST BE DE-ENERGIZED (ths mght nclude dsconnectng the cable from the battery) before matng or unmatng the connectors. STOP The connectors must NOT be forced to mate or unmate. When fully mated, the housngs must appear flush at the pont of engagement Repar The contact, housng, and reducng busng are not reparable. Damaged or defectve contacts, housngs, or reducng bushngs must not be used. The contacts or reducng bushngs must not be re-used by removng the wre. 4. QUALIFICATION Power Seres 50 connector assembles are Component Recognzed by Underwrters Laboratores Inc. (UL) n Fle E28476 and have been Investgated to CSA Internatonal Standards by UL. 5.
